United States Casualties in Afghanistan Soaring

United States Casualties in Afghanistan Soaring

July 31, 2010 – U.S. military death tolls in Afghanistan are on the rise this summer. July has seen sixty-six American casualties. This has surpassed the previous record high set last month..

BP Testing New Well Cap on Runaway Gulf of Mexico Oil Spill

BP Testing New Well Cap on Runaway Gulf of Mexico Oil Spill

July 13, 2010 – BP announced on Monday that they successfully attached a new cap to the Deep Water Horizon well that has been gushing oil into the Gulf of Mexico since April 20.

Pelosi Says BP Misrepresented Their Technology – Obama Orders Attorney General to Investigate

Pelosi Says BP Misrepresented Their Technology - Obama Orders Attorney General to Investigate

July 12, 2010 – On Thursday researchers doubled their estimates on the amount of oil that has spewing into the Gulf of Mexico after BP’s oil rig exploded in April.

They now say that 1.7 million gallons per day – more than forty thousand barrels – have been gushing into the Gulf for weeks.

Online Identity Theft Strikes 10% of Australia

online identity theft

July 6, 2010 – A new survey of 2,500 Australians indicates that an alarmingly large number have become victims of online identity theft. One out of every ten people surveyed said they lost, on average, $1,000 each.
